Georgetown – U.S. Ambassador Sarah-Ann Lynch addressed members of the Overseas Security Advisory Council (OSAC) at a recent meeting of the group.

OSAC’s mission is to build cooperation between the public and private sectors to address security issues in Guyana.

In her remarks, Ambassador Lynch said that focusing on safety and security helps put a country on the path to prosperity. “Nothing says consumer confidence,” she said, “like a safe place to live and raise a family.” She assured the OSAC members that the U.S. Embassy is prepared to work with OSAC to connect Guyana’s leadership with U.S. experts who can provide guidance on security issues.
